pub async fn db_init() -> SqlitePool {
let db_url = make_database_url();
if !Sqlite::database_exists(&db_url).await.unwrap_or(false) {
Sqlite::create_database(&db_url)
.await
.expect("failed to create database");
}
let db = SqlitePool::connect(&db_url).await.unwrap();
sqlx::migrate!().run(&db).await.unwrap();
db
}
